Abstract


In this article, we have studied the variation of the electrical performance characteristics of photovoltaic modules under the effect of dust. We have installed four modules of different technologies on the CERER site (Centre for Study and Research on Renewable Energies) for a year without being cleaned and each month we note their characteristics. The four technologies used are mono crystalline, polycrystalline, amorphous and thin film CdTe. The results showed that dust has more impact on thin film technology with a degradation of 68% of its power and less impact on amorphous which experienced a 29% loss in power.
